WebSep 22, 2024 · Australia experiences about 80 magnitude-3 and larger earthquakes a year, although the majority are small. The largest recorded earthquake in Australia was a magnitude-6.6 at the sparsely populated Tennant Creek, NT in 1988. Two similar-sized earthquakes followed within 12 hours and aftershocks are still being recorded today.

WebSep 22, 2024 · In Australia we get magnitude 5.8-6.0 or greater earthquakes, on average, once every four to 20 years. The highest since instrumental records began in Australia was the magnitude 6.6 quake in... WebFeb 16, 2015 · Earthquakes in Australia have also resulted in significant damage and loss of life. This was certainly the case with the magnitude 5.6 Newcastle earthquake in 1989, which killed 13 people and... Seismic waves were felt across several major cities including Melbourne, Canberra, Sydney and Adelaide, and as far south as Tasmania. simply seagreens gmbhWebIn eastern Australia, earthquakes occur to depths of about 20 km. Less than 5 km are regarded as shallow, while those at depths greater than 15 km are deep. The largest quake in Australia during the past 100 years was a magnitude 6.7 event in the Northern Territory on 22 Jan 1988 .
